Output ac2673e6895e89879ef817b8559458478527c450625968b3993d2dd42a5c31e9:1

value
10500293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3de1da1fe8de35ed3ee2a7d1a39536475e0421 OP_EQUAL
address
MHrn1zXq3sYqEsUB26rXvqk1oWzfiPXuXX
transaction
ac2673e6895e89879ef817b8559458478527c450625968b3993d2dd42a5c31e9
spent
true